Migrate to Pusher: Complete Migration Service
Migrate to Pusher: Complete Migration Service
Moving your real-time communication infrastructure to Pusher represents a significant step toward scalability and reliability. Whether you're operating on legacy systems or looking to modernize your existing setup, a Pusher migration can streamline your operations and reduce technical debt. This comprehensive guide explores the migration process, key considerations, and how platforms like PROMETHEUS can facilitate a smooth transition to Pusher's robust infrastructure.
Understanding the Pusher Migration Landscape
Pusher has become the industry standard for real-time messaging, powering over 100,000 applications worldwide. The platform handles approximately 15 billion messages per month, making it a trusted choice for enterprises requiring reliable WebSocket infrastructure. A successful Pusher migration involves transferring your real-time communication layer while maintaining zero downtime and ensuring data integrity throughout the process.
The migration journey typically involves three phases: assessment, implementation, and validation. Organizations report that proper planning reduces migration time by 40-60% compared to unplanned transitions. PROMETHEUS offers specialized tools that integrate seamlessly with Pusher, automating many aspects of this complex process and providing real-time monitoring during the transition period.
- Average migration window: 4-8 weeks depending on complexity
- Typical cost reduction: 25-35% through optimized resource allocation
- Performance improvement: 45% faster message delivery on average
- Team hours required: 80-120 hours for medium-sized applications
Assessing Your Current Infrastructure
Before initiating any cloud migration effort, comprehensive assessment of your existing real-time communication system is essential. This evaluation determines compatibility, identifies potential bottlenecks, and establishes clear baseline metrics. Your assessment should examine connection limits, message throughput, latency requirements, and current user concurrency levels.
Organizations using PROMETHEUS Dev tools gain significant advantages during this phase. The platform provides detailed analytics dashboards that reveal usage patterns, peak traffic times, and resource constraints. These insights enable more accurate capacity planning and help identify which components require immediate attention before the migration begins.
Key metrics to document include:
- Peak concurrent connections currently supported
- Average message volume per hour
- Current latency measurements (p50, p95, p99)
- Geographical distribution of your user base
- Existing authentication and authorization mechanisms
- Custom channel naming conventions and hierarchy
Implementing Your Pusher Migration Strategy
Successful implementation requires a phased approach that minimizes risk and allows for rollback if issues arise. The most effective strategy involves parallel running, where both your legacy system and Pusher operate simultaneously during an initial transition period. This approach reduces downtime to seconds rather than hours and provides confidence that everything works as expected.
Start by creating a sandbox environment that mirrors your production setup. Test all client implementations, server-side channels, and authentication flows thoroughly. PROMETHEUS Dev provides simulation capabilities that can generate realistic traffic patterns, allowing you to validate performance under expected load conditions before cutting over to production.
Implementation timeline typically follows this structure:
- Week 1-2: Environment setup and credential configuration
- Week 3: Client library integration and testing
- Week 4-5: Authentication layer migration
- Week 6: Parallel running validation
- Week 7: Production cutover
- Week 8: Monitoring and optimization
During implementation, PROMETHEUS Dev becomes invaluable for tracking progress metrics. The platform monitors API response times, connection establishment rates, and message delivery success. Organizations using PROMETHEUS report 95% confidence in their migration readiness before production deployment.
Managing the Cloud Migration Process
A successful cloud migration to Pusher requires careful change management and stakeholder communication. Beyond the technical aspects, your team needs clear documentation, training materials, and support structures. Pusher provides comprehensive API documentation, but having PROMETHEUS Dev as an additional resource layer helps your developers understand implementation specifics relevant to your use case.
Communication strategy should include:
- Weekly status updates for technical stakeholders
- Risk register and contingency planning documents
- Rollback procedures documented and tested
- Support escalation contacts clearly defined
- Post-migration optimization roadmap established
Data integrity verification is crucial during cloud migration. Implement comprehensive logging to track every message through the system. PROMETHEUS provides audit trails that ensure no messages are lost during the transition. Set tolerance thresholds before migration—most organizations accept zero message loss as a requirement.
Post-Migration Optimization and Monitoring
Completing the technical cutover represents just 60% of a successful Pusher migration. The remaining 40% involves optimization, performance tuning, and establishing ongoing monitoring practices. Pusher Dev environments allow you to experiment with configuration changes before applying them to production.
Key optimization areas include:
- Channel subscription patterns: Analyze which channels receive the most traffic and optimize accordingly
- Message batching: Group related messages to reduce individual API calls
- Connection pooling: Implement efficient connection reuse strategies
- Geographic distribution: Leverage Pusher's global CDN for reduced latency
- Cost optimization: Review your pricing tier based on actual usage patterns
PROMETHEUS provides ongoing monitoring dashboards that track critical metrics post-migration. These dashboards surface anomalies, unexpected traffic patterns, and performance degradations. Organizations that maintain PROMETHEUS monitoring report 40% fewer production incidents in the six months following migration.
Leveraging PROMETHEUS for Migration Success
PROMETHEUS stands out as a comprehensive platform that bridges the gap between legacy systems and modern infrastructure like Pusher. The synthetic intelligence capabilities built into PROMETHEUS enable predictive analysis of your migration impact before changes go live. This Prometheus Dev approach to testing reduces surprises and accelerates confidence in your migration timeline.
The platform's API integration toolkit provides pre-built connectors for Pusher authentication, channel management, and event handling. These connectors eliminate boilerplate code and focus development efforts on business logic rather than infrastructure complexity. Users of PROMETHEUS report 50% faster implementation compared to manual configuration.
Whether you're migrating from Socket.io, Firebase Realtime Database, or custom WebSocket implementations, PROMETHEUS serves as your unified platform for planning, executing, and validating the transition to Pusher. The platform's analytics capabilities continue providing value long after migration completion, helping optimize resource allocation and identify opportunities for additional cost savings.
Your successful Pusher migration journey begins with a strategic assessment and continues through careful implementation with proper tooling and monitoring. Start your transformation today by exploring PROMETHEUS's migration capabilities—the platform offers comprehensive documentation, sandbox environments, and dedicated support to ensure your transition to Pusher becomes a competitive advantage for your organization.
Frequently Asked Questions
how do I migrate to Pusher with PROMETHEUS
PROMETHEUS offers a complete migration service that handles the transfer of your real-time messaging infrastructure to Pusher with minimal downtime. The service includes data mapping, configuration setup, and testing to ensure your channels and events are properly configured in Pusher's platform.
what's included in PROMETHEUS migration to Pusher
PROMETHEUS's migration service includes assessment of your current setup, channel and event migration, authentication configuration, API endpoint updates, and post-migration testing and validation. The team also provides documentation and support during the transition period to minimize disruption to your application.
how long does it take to migrate to Pusher using PROMETHEUS
Migration timelines vary depending on your system complexity, but PROMETHEUS typically completes migrations within 1-4 weeks including planning, execution, and testing phases. For smaller implementations, the process can be completed in as little as a few days.
will my app have downtime during Pusher migration with PROMETHEUS
PROMETHEUS designs migrations to minimize downtime through careful planning and coordination, often achieving zero-downtime migrations using gradual traffic switching techniques. The exact downtime depends on your architecture, but the service prioritizes keeping your real-time features operational throughout the process.
does PROMETHEUS handle data migration when switching to Pusher
Yes, PROMETHEUS's migration service includes transferring your channel configurations, authentication rules, and event schemas to Pusher. However, historical message data typically isn't migrated as Pusher focuses on real-time messaging; PROMETHEUS will advise you on archiving historical data if needed.
what support does PROMETHEUS provide after migrating to Pusher
PROMETHEUS provides post-migration support including monitoring, troubleshooting, performance optimization, and training for your team on Pusher's platform. They typically offer a support period ranging from 2-4 weeks after go-live to ensure stability and address any integration issues.